Joan P. (Peabody) Driscoll, 91 April 14, 1933 - July 13, 2024

BOXFORD – Joan P. (Peabody) Driscoll, 91, of Boxford passed away peacefully on Saturday, July 13 at Anna Jaques Hospital in Newburyport.

Joan was born in Lynn to Joseph E. and Yvonne (Frazier) Peabody. She was a graduate of Lynn English High School, Class of 1951. Joan worked as a bookkeeper until her retirement; she enjoyed bingo and loved the beaches and the ocean and never missed her grandchildren’s sporting events. Joan was all about her family, a devoted mother, grandmother, great grandmother, sister and aunt.

Joan is survived by her children Cynthia Reifel and her partner Patrick Churchyard of Beverly, Darlene Harris and her partner Donald Hutchings of Haverhill, Robert Driscoll, Jr. of Boxford, Douglas Driscoll of Boxford, Kendra Bornstein and her partner Jeff Diab of Bradford, and Stephanie Driscoll of Salisbury and former sons in law Harry Reifel and David Bornstein. She also leaves behind her six grandchildren Bruce Moulton, Ashley Cruz, Andrew Reifel, Cameron Scarpa, Louis Bornstein and Lacey Bornstein and her three great grandchildren Jaiden Cruz, Hailey Cruz an Cooper Moulton; and several nieces and nephews. She was predeceased by her siblings Ruth Sena, Dorothy Morehouse, Norma Kelly, Rita Calef, Marnie Derosier and Frank Peabody.
